多因素影响下煤层底板变形破坏规律研究
RESEARCH OF THE COAL SEAM FLOOR’S STRAIN AND FRACTURE REGULARITY INFLUENCED BY SEVERAL FACTS
【摘要】 利用快速拉格朗日分析方法,单因素分析了工作面斜长和构造应力对煤层底板应力应变的影响。提出水平构造应力是煤层底板变形破坏不可忽略的重要因素之一。综合分析了煤层倾角、煤层埋藏深度、工作面斜长和构造应力影响下煤层底板的变形破坏规律,得到了煤层底板最大破坏深度计算公式。
【Abstract】 In this paper,by usage of Fast Lagrangian Analysis of Continua,analysis the coal seam floor′s stress and strain regularity influenced by the facing length and the construct stress.Point out that the horizontal structure stress is one of the important influence factors on the coal seam floor′s failure.And we comprehensively analysis the influence regularity of coal seam floor which is strained or distorted with the slop angle of coal seam,the depth of coal seam,the construct stress and the facing length,provide the equation of the coal seam floor′s failure depth.
